Exploring the Ancient Petroglyphs

The Jones Hole Trail is renowned for its ancient petroglyphs, a significant cultural heritage site. These rock carvings, created by the Fremont and Ute peoples, offer a direct connection to the area's past inhabitants. Visitors are encouraged to observe these historical markings respectfully from a distance, ensuring their preservation for future generations. The petroglyphs are scattered along the trail, adding an element of discovery to your hike. Reddit

It's crucial to remember that these are not just drawings but sacred artifacts. Touching or defacing them is strictly prohibited and can cause irreparable damage. The park service works to protect these sites, and visitor cooperation is essential. The sheer age and artistry of these carvings are awe-inspiring, making this a highlight for many who visit. The Serenity of Ely Creek Falls and the Green River

As you continue along the Jones Hole Trail, you'll reach the picturesque Ely Creek Falls. This gentle cascade provides a tranquil spot to pause and enjoy the natural beauty of the canyon. It's a refreshing sight, especially on a warm day. The sound of the water adds to the peaceful ambiance of the hike. Reddit

Further along, the trail culminates at the banks of the mighty Green River. This is a popular spot for a picnic lunch, offering stunning views of the water flowing through the rugged desert landscape. The contrast between the arid surroundings and the life-giving river is striking. Many visitors find this a perfect place to relax, reflect, and soak in the vastness of Dinosaur National Monument. Wildlife Encounters on the Trail

One of the unexpected joys of hiking the Jones Hole Trail is the opportunity for wildlife sightings. Keep your eyes peeled for desert mountain goats navigating the rocky slopes and graceful antelopes grazing in the open areas. These encounters add an exciting dimension to the hike, reminding you of the vibrant ecosystem that thrives in this seemingly harsh environment. Reddit

Early morning and late afternoon are generally the best times to spot animals as they are more active during these cooler parts of the day. Remember to maintain a safe distance and never feed the wildlife. Observing these creatures in their natural habitat is a privilege and a testament to the conservation efforts within Dinosaur National Monument. Reddit
